Dark and dangerous dreams Surface at night Causing her to awake Out of fright You can't blame her Her actions are untamed Because seeing visions of terror Is hard for her to sustain The psychiatrist asks her To thoroughly explain But she can't She feels so ashamed So the psychiatrist asks her 'What is there to be ashamed about?' 'Is your self esteem low?' 'Are you having feelings of doubt?' She continues to stare on With a blank expression Causing the doctor To boil with aggression However this girl Does not seem to care As much as uttering one syllable She wouldn't dare What is it that causes her To act this way? IS it really that frightening For her to say? What is it that she is so afraid Of putting on display The psychiatrist continues to stare at this girl Bewildered in dismay So he decides to hang up his coat And just call it day The girl goes home wondering Why this nightmare was so hard for her to reveal I guess now her only solution is to spend some time alone To discover how it really makes her feel By Glenn McCrary © 2009 Glenn McCrary (All rights reserved)
